| Has anyone done a frozen egg transfer with Dr. Sacks? Can you share with me your protocol? Just nervous about the FET in general, not Dr. Sacks. Would love some reassurance. |
|
I have done three with Dr. Sacks and they were all natural cycle FETs. I would start monitoring around day 9 or 10 until I had an LH surge, then I would go in two days later to check my progesterone. We would then do the transfer 6 days after I ovulated.
I don't have any experience with a medicated FET. |
| I've done 2 FET cycles with Dr. Sacks, both natural cycle. It consisted of bloodwork every other day until ovulation had occured, with occasional ultrasounds early on to check status of lining and otherwise ensure that cycle was normal. Transfer was 5 days after ovulation. |
| I did a medicated FET with Dr Sacks in July 2007. I had a failed fresh cycle on June 27th and then got my +ve on my FET on July 27th so that is how long the cycle took. If I recall, no shots occured and just a simple pill every day through to transfer and then of course progesterone. I don't seem to remember more than one u/s. I just remember it was incredibly non-eventful compared to all that went into a fresh cycle. We transferred 2 and have 2 yr old twins. Wishing you success also. |
